Forget which quilting expert was on an ancient Alex Anderson show, but her reference was the 'ppm' personal piecing measurement. In other words, consistency. I think if we can get our blocks to be very close, make the points match, etc., we are there. While striving for perfection, without the stress of it, should be our goal...none of us is perfect. Ergo, our quilts will not be perfect either. While I'm not an overly religious person, I do believe that only God is perfect and we can only be close to that. It works for me. I make my quilts with love and if there are a few booboos along the way, well, that's what makes something handmade, does it not?
